Based on a series of experiments, the theory of relationship between normal pressure and pores characters fit for polymer was set up for the first time. On the study of relation between normal pressure and porosity, experience model of polyimide porous materials was proposed which is similar to the traditional experience model of the metal porous material. While being pressed, polyimide was found soon to come into elasto-plastic deformation progress in this paper, so the theory model of metal porous material based on Hooker's law was not fit for the polymer any more. A new elasto-plastic deformation and exhausting model is proposed which shows better agreement with polymer material's pressing process.
